Project Overview

ANWETECH supplied an NH3 ammonia gas detection system for TP Marcelo Company Incorporated in the Philippines, a cold storage and ice manufacturing plant where ammonia is commonly used in the refrigeration process.

In cold storage and ice production facilities, NH3 ammonia is an efficient industrial refrigerant, but it also requires strict leakage monitoring. If ammonia gas leaks from refrigeration compressors, valves, pipelines, evaporators, or machine rooms, it may create safety risks for workers, equipment, and daily plant operation.

To improve site safety, ANWETECH provided 2 gas control panels and 6 NH3 gas detectors for continuous ammonia gas monitoring. The system is designed to detect ammonia leakage at critical points and provide alarm signals before the gas concentration reaches a dangerous level.

System Deployment

The NH3 gas detectors were installed at key risk areas of the cold storage and ice manufacturing plant, including:

  • Refrigeration machine room
  • Compressor area
  • Ammonia pipeline and valve areas
  • Cold storage technical zones
  • Ice manufacturing equipment area
  • Other potential ammonia leakage points

Each detector continuously monitors the NH3 concentration in the surrounding environment and transmits the signal to the gas control panel. When the ammonia concentration reaches the preset alarm level, the system can provide alarm indication and output signals for emergency response.

This configuration helps the facility build a more reliable gas safety monitoring system for daily refrigeration operation.

Product Features

The ANWETECH NH3 gas detector used in this project is an industrial fixed gas detector suitable for continuous gas leakage monitoring.

Main features include:

  • Real-time NH3 gas concentration monitoring
  • DC24V power supply
  • 4-20mA analog signal output
  • RS485 Modbus RTU communication
  • Passive relay contact output
  • Two-level alarm output
  • Die-cast aluminum housing
  • Explosion-proof design: Ex d IIC T6
  • IP66 ingress protection
  • Operating temperature: -40°C to +70°C
  • Suitable for industrial and hazardous area applications

The detector can be connected to gas control panels, PLC systems, ventilation systems, sounder beacon alarms, or other safety control equipment according to project requirements.

Engineering Installation Considerations

For NH3 ammonia gas detection, detector location is very important.

Ammonia is lighter than air, so the detector should normally be installed above the possible leakage source or in an upper area where ammonia gas may accumulate. The sensor head should face downward to ensure stable gas sampling and better long-term protection.

During installation, engineers should consider:

  • Install close to possible NH3 leakage sources
  • Avoid strong vibration
  • Avoid direct water spray or heavy condensation
  • Keep enough space for maintenance and calibration
  • Avoid strong electromagnetic interference
  • Ensure correct DC24V power and signal wiring
  • Perform regular inspection and calibration

A correct installation position is essential for early ammonia leakage detection.
